Which option do I choose?
garik1379 [7]

Answer:

  Does exist -- It only exists when the determinant does not equal zero.

Step-by-step explanation:

The inverse of a matrix is the transpose of the cofactor matrix, divided by the determinant. If the determinant is zero, the result of the division is undefined and the inverse does not exist.

__

For this matrix, the determinant is (-2)(18) -(9)(4) = -72. The inverse exists.
